首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

查看pc软件监听的端口号

查看PC软件监听的端口号,通常是为了诊断网络连接问题或确保软件正常运行。以下是基础概念及相关操作步骤:

基础概念

端口号:在TCP/IP协议中,端口号用于区分不同的网络服务。每个网络应用程序在运行时都会绑定到一个特定的端口号。

监听端口:当一个软件或服务准备接收数据时,它会“监听”指定的端口。这意味着它在该端口上等待传入的连接请求。

查看方法

在Windows系统中:

  1. 使用命令提示符
    • 打开“开始”菜单,输入cmd并按回车键打开命令提示符。
    • 输入以下命令查看所有监听端口及其对应的服务:
    • 输入以下命令查看所有监听端口及其对应的服务:
    • 若要查找特定软件监听的端口,可以使用findstr命令过滤结果,例如:
    • 若要查找特定软件监听的端口,可以使用findstr命令过滤结果,例如:
  • 使用资源监视器
    • 打开“任务管理器”,切换到“性能”选项卡。
    • 点击“打开资源监视器”。
    • 在资源监视器的“网络”选项卡下,可以查看每个进程的网络活动,包括它们监听的端口。

在Linux系统中:

  1. 使用netstat命令
    • 打开终端。
    • 输入以下命令查看所有监听端口:
    • 输入以下命令查看所有监听端口:
    • 若要查找特定软件监听的端口,可以使用grep命令过滤结果,例如:
    • 若要查找特定软件监听的端口,可以使用grep命令过滤结果,例如:
  • 使用ss命令
    • ss命令是netstat的一个更快的替代品。
    • 输入以下命令查看监听端口:
    • 输入以下命令查看监听端口:

应用场景

  • 故障排除:当网络连接出现问题时,查看软件监听的端口可以帮助确定是否是端口冲突或被防火墙阻止。
  • 安全审计:定期检查系统中正在监听的端口有助于发现潜在的安全风险。
  • 服务配置验证:确保服务器上的服务正确配置并监听预期的端口。

常见问题及解决方法

  • 端口被占用:如果发现某个端口已被其他进程占用,可以使用lsof(Linux)或Resource Monitor(Windows)找出占用端口的进程并决定是否终止它。
  • 防火墙阻止:确保操作系统的防火墙设置允许软件通过所需端口进行通信。
  • 软件配置错误:检查软件的配置文件,确保它指定了正确的端口号。

通过以上方法,您可以有效地查看和管理PC软件监听的端口号。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券